Our hearts broke for Allison Holker Boss when her husband, Stephen Twitch Boss (a fixture on The Ellen DeGeneres Show and an incredible dancer), took his own life a little over a year ago.
Allison instantly became a single mom of three, navigating the unimaginable.
So, how do we talk to our children about grief and loss? Whether it’s losing a loved one, the loss of a relationship, or any of us trying to find our way in a season of hurt.
Allison recently became a judge on FOX’s So You Think You Can Dance. And I think you’ll be encouraged to hear how she’s doing, how she’s leading her children through loss and grief, what she tells Stephen every night, and why she’s decided to release the kids' book they’d been working on before his death, called KEEP DANCING THROUGH.

In this episode, we delve into accepting our purpose and being fully ourselves, how we can support and care for loved ones who are walking through grief, and navigating complex conversations about loss with our kids while holding space for our own pain.
